Where'd you like to go?
[]
Enter
My Profile
Edit your profile
Close session
Write an opinion
Publish
+2
--
Opening Hours
[]
+44(020)72216119
+44(020)72216119
Phone number

2 reviews of Cafe Garcia

Los García

This London restaurant-store feels like being in the heart of Spain. Every time I have visited London, I make a visit to Garcia and Son. The food is great, I recommend it.

See original
Have you been here?
Add your opinion and photos and help other travelers discover
[]

Information about Cafe Garcia

Links to Cafe Garcia